Job Summary
This position provides the full breadth of Child and Youth Behavioral counseling services to military families at Guantanamo Bay, Cuba.
Candidates must be a licensed clinician at the independent practice level in any US state and willing to travel for 6 months to a year.
The role includes providing non-medical counseling, parent training, and consultation while maintaining strict confidentiality and following DoD protocols.
